Matt Pell, 2 time All-American and Gorarrian award winner, spars with Nick Gregoris. Nick Gregoris is the Missouri 157 lbs starter. Matt Pell and Nick discuss the benefits of this type of workout and how it feels. Matt Pell returned to the University of Missouri wrestling team after coaching at the University of Virginia under Steve Garland.

In jui-jitsu this is called a slow roll....you can go like this for 45 minutes or more and you learn what works and what doesn't.......you develop technique without going full bore. I'm 52 and it allows me to spar more at this pace. I still go live and I still compete but the body pays a price for those live sessions. I think like Matt in that I want to do this when I'm 90......Good Lord willing.

The value of this kind of 'free practice' can't be overstated. A ton of learning happens and Pell breaks down the various aspects - ideas, experimentation, increased mat awareness, flow and movement. Once an effective technique is identified, then it can be drilled to solidify muscle memory. This is the preceding step, when new techniques and variations are discovered.
